Transaction 23efc5110569ff0ccaae77c921dbb724f00b8d5fbb02e9f67c25188d2a056e2f

1 Input
2 Outputs
  • 23efc5110569ff0ccaae77c921dbb724f00b8d5fbb02e9f67c25188d2a056e2f:0
  • value  500200
    address  1JKBJUXyRbktjhwQNxBTeFSQikj4cmwSXS
  • 23efc5110569ff0ccaae77c921dbb724f00b8d5fbb02e9f67c25188d2a056e2f:1
  • value  3407235
    address  bc1qszjmydaycdg77f6tqt3f3cgqmzx58mzc7hcfju